Abstract

The THF-stabilized methylzirconocene salt [Cp2ZrCH3(THF)+]BPh4- (2) was treated with excess H2O in dichloromethane/THF at −78 °C to yield the trinuclear metallocene oxide cation complex [(Cp2Zr)3(μ2-OH)3(μ3-O)+]BPh4-·3THF (1+BPh4-) in 72% yield. The complex 1+BPh4- was characterized by X-ray diffraction. It exhibits a planar central Zr3O3 hexagon having the μ3-O ligand in its center. Each of the three oxygen atoms at the perimeter is protonated and in the crystal connected to a THF molecule by means of a weak hydrogen bond. The byproduct THF·BPh3 (3) was crystallized from the THF mother liquor and identified by X-ray diffraction.
